Join us for our monthly poetry series celebrating the Latinidad of the Latino Cultural District. This series focuses on the experiences of people of color in the Bay Area, featuring local poets chosen from the Mission’s deep literary culture. Each reading features an established poet and a newcomer. You can join our Facebook page for more! 

The series is presented by Friends and curated by a committee of Misión based poets, including San Francisco Poet Laureate Kim Shuck. Interested in reading or joining our committee? Contact brenda.salguero@friendssfpl.org or call 415-477-5223.  


Note: Thursdays en la Misión is a curated reading. The participating poets are invited to read and the schedule is set up well in advance of the events. Only when a scheduled poet cancels too late to locate a substitute do we revert to an open reading format.
